Research has shown that early experiences can influence later romantic partnerships and sexual behavior.

Children who grow up in families where their parents are open about love and affection tend to be more comfortable expressing these feelings themselves. In contrast, those whose parents were less demonstrative may have difficulty initiating intimate relationships as adults. This paper will explore how such experiences impact an individual's sexual attraction and responsiveness during adulthood.

The first factor is attachment style, which refers to how people form bonds with others. Secure individuals feel comfortable expressing emotions, while insecure ones struggle with intimacy. Those raised in secure homes tend to seek out similarly attached partners, while insecure people often choose unavailable or unsupportive partners. The result is different levels of trust, leading to dissimilar responses to sexual encounters.

Secure individuals may feel comfortable exploring new sensations, but insecure ones may be reluctant to try new things.

Another important aspect is communication. Children learn to communicate through observation, so if parents show warmth and openness in sharing feelings, they will likely do the same when forming relationships. Conversely, those who witness hostility may struggle to express emotions, potentially affecting their sex lives. Similarly, parents' attitudes towards sex affect children's perceptions, leading them to either accept it or reject it. If a child sees sexuality as shameful or dangerous, they may avoid sexual activities even though they are healthy and normal.

Experiences also shape our preferences for particular body types or characteristics. Children absorb messages from society regarding what is desirable, and this can influence later choices.

Girls whose parents praise weight loss might prioritize thin bodies over those who praise curves. Likewise, boys may seek out partners similar to their fathers or mothers based on physical appearance.

Early life experiences play a crucial role in shaping adult sexual attraction and responsiveness. Attachment style, communication skills, and parental attitudes all contribute to one's comfort level and willingness to explore sexuality. By understanding these factors, we can better support healthy romantic and intimate relationships.
